> (1) Initailly i installed Dspace 1.4.1 and associated software
> (java,tomcat,postgresql) in "machine1" and imported few items through
> batch import. DSpace is working fine. 
> (2) later it was decided to have 2 tier implementation, " machine1"
> with DB and "machineweb2" with Dspace, java, and Tomcat. The previous
> configuration of "machine1" was not changed since DSpace was working
> fine. In "machineweb2" i installed JDK, Tomcat and extracted DSpace
> 1.4.1. When "ant fresh_install" was given at DSpace source - bin, the
> build was unsuccessful. 

This is the problem. When you run ant fresh_install it tries to do
everything, including populating the database. All you need to do on
machineweb2 is ant update (and maybe ant init_configs). You shouldn't
need to do anything to the database structure on machine1.

> On Mon, Apr 02, 2007 at 03:57:55PM +0800, Jayan Chirayath Kurian wrote:
> > (3) when "ant fresh_install" was given from client machine, the DB
> > connection error was not seen but build was not successful. I just
> > copied the war files to Tomcat webapp folder. Accessing and browsing
> > items was fine. But submitting a new item gives an internal error. Since
> > I have not properly build DSpace, the log file was not seen. I am
> > attaching the command line output when I execute "ant fresh_install".
> > The error starts with "PSQLException: ERROR: function "getnextid"
> > already exists with same argument types". Please suggest.
> 
> This error is being thrown because the database structure already
> exists. How are you able to "access and browse" items if you can't
> submit them? It's difficult to figure out exactly how far you've got
> with your installation; if you haven't successfully completed a
> fresh_install, you shouldn't deploy the WARs and start using DSpace.
> Deploying DSpace half-built is definitely a Bad Idea.
> 
> If there is no content in your database, I would recommend dropping it
> and starting again with a fresh_install.
